Transaction c628261ed9f396ecaf40594d3c1906a5f7c6e21617ab936910bb4277e17d7ad6
1 Input
2 Outputs
- c628261ed9f396ecaf40594d3c1906a5f7c6e21617ab936910bb4277e17d7ad6:0
- c628261ed9f396ecaf40594d3c1906a5f7c6e21617ab936910bb4277e17d7ad6:1
value 45000000
address 1Kp13ZUe5nLLuzZ7tSnXTJzGdpEwMY5JVh
value 40118193
address 1JFrkuTfz5t4vRvEkTziufsgAoAuwgVtHj